#358e57 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#358e57 is composed of 20.8% red, 55.7% green and 34.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 62.7% cyan, 0% magenta, 38.7% yellow and 44.3% black. It has a hue angle of 142.9 degrees, a saturation of 45.6% and a lightness of 38.2%. #358e57 color hex could be obtained by blending #6affae with #001d00. Closest websafe color is: #339966.

Shades and Tints of #358e57

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050d08 is the darkest color, while #fefffe is the lightest one.

Tones of #358e57

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#5b6960 is the less saturated color, while #00c34b is the most saturated one.
